Amorgos has one of the most impressive monasteries in the Cyclades. The reason for Panagia Hozoviotissa.
Amorgos and Panagia Hozoviotissa
The monastery of Panagia Hozoviotissa is built on the wild mountain peaks of Amorgos. It seems to be literally hanging next to the gap, having a unique view of the endless blue of the Aegean. The monastery was built in 1088 and renovated by the Byzantine emperor Alexios Komnenos.
The reason for the construction of the monastery was the finding of an icon of the Virgin Mary that arrived from Hozovo or Hozova in Palestine. It is said that due to the persecution of Christians in the 9th century, the icon moved and miraculously reached Amorgos.

Legend has it that the location was chosen by the Virgin Mary herself. Although the monastery underwent several changes over the centuries, and especially during the Venetian era (1296-1537), its special character did not change. In fact, it has been inhabited continuously for 900 years, without interruption even during the Turkish occupation.
The length of the monastery is estimated at 40 meters, while its width is only 5 meters. The 300 impressive stone steps lead you from the road to the entrance. If you tour the monastery you will notice that there are narrow stone stairs through which you can reach all 8 floors of the monastery, as well as all its wings.

The cycladic monastery today
Nowadays, ovens and kitchens do not work. The bank opens for the faithful on November 21 at the Entrances of the Virgin. In 1977, the Monastery was renovated. Then the three small cells were joined. Thus, visitors can wander around the relics of the Monastery and are given the opportunity to try the established treat by the monks with citrus and Turkish delight.
